study guides for every class

that actually explain what's on your next test

Pivot_table

from class:

Data Journalism

Definition

A pivot table is a data processing technique used in data analysis to summarize, reorganize, and aggregate data from a larger dataset, enabling users to extract meaningful insights. It allows for easy manipulation and comparison of datasets by transforming rows into columns and vice versa, which is particularly useful for identifying trends and patterns in data. This tool is especially powerful when working with libraries like Pandas in Python, making it essential for data analysis and visualization tasks.

congrats on reading the definition of pivot_table.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Pivot tables can easily be created using the `pivot_table` function in Pandas, allowing users to specify index columns, column names, and aggregation functions.
  2. They are particularly useful for analyzing large datasets where direct visual analysis would be cumbersome, enabling quick insights by summarizing data effectively.
  3. Pivot tables can include multiple levels of aggregation and can also be customized to display different statistical measures such as averages or sums.
  4. They facilitate the comparison of different categories within the dataset by restructuring the way data is presented, thus enhancing visual interpretation.
  5. When using pivot tables, missing values can be handled gracefully by specifying how they should be treated during the aggregation process.

Review Questions

  • How does the `pivot_table` function in Pandas enhance the ability to analyze large datasets?
    • The `pivot_table` function enhances data analysis by summarizing large datasets into more manageable formats that highlight key trends and patterns. By transforming rows into columns and applying aggregation functions like sum or mean, users can easily compare different categories within their data. This makes it simpler to draw insights without needing to sift through extensive raw data, streamlining the analysis process significantly.
  • In what ways can pivot tables be customized to improve data visualization and interpretation?
    • Pivot tables can be customized in several ways to enhance data visualization and interpretation. Users can specify which columns to use as indices and which ones should become new columns, enabling a tailored view of the data. Additionally, they can choose different aggregation functions such as counts or averages, allowing for deeper insights into specific metrics. The ability to format tables with styles also helps highlight important findings visually.
  • Evaluate the role of pivot tables in conjunction with other data manipulation techniques such as GroupBy and aggregation within Python's Pandas library.
    • Pivot tables play a crucial role when combined with other data manipulation techniques like GroupBy and aggregation in Pandas. While GroupBy allows for initial segmentation of data based on specific criteria and provides aggregate values, pivot tables take it further by restructuring this summarized data into an easily interpretable format. This synergy enables analysts to not only summarize large datasets effectively but also visualize relationships between different variables at various levels of detail. Ultimately, this holistic approach leads to richer insights and more informed decision-making.

"Pivot_table" also found in:

©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.